Schlumberger Opens Reservoir Completions Manufacturing Center
in Saudi Arabia
Facility Offers Flexibility in Manufacturing and Custom Design through Collaboration in Technology Development
DHAHRAN, 6 October 2009 – Schlumberger announced today the opening of the new reservoir completions manufacturing center in Dammam,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. The new center, located in the Dammam Industrial City represents an investment of approximately $25M in state-of-the-art manufacturing equipment, facility lease and inventory and houses a team of design and manufacturing engineers specialized in the production of customized downhole reservoir completions equipment. More particularly, the center provides a collaborative environment in which joint oil company and Schlumberger teams can develop and manufacture completions solutions for applications across the range of reservoir types found in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ia and the Middle East.

Manufacturing operations will begin with a number of products for immediate application in Saudi Arabia. These include single wire-wrapped screens with a unique shrink-fit design, inflow control devices for production wells, and injection control devices to control the profile of water injection wells. Many of these technologies have already been successfully installed based on joint efforts between Saudi Aramco and Schlumberger to achieve maximum reservoir contact and associated production goals.

The center is the first true manufacturing facility of its kind in Saudi Arabia. As part of the global Schlumberger technology organization, the center will draw on expertise and support from the company’s worldwide network of 20 research and engineering facilities in 12 countries. In addition, the nearby Schlumberger Dhahran Carbonate Research Center will be available to provide key technology insight and support.

About Saudi Aramco
Owned by the Saudi Arabian Government, Saudi Aramco is a fully-integrated, global petroleum enterprise, and a world leader in exploration and producing, refining, distribution, shipping and marketing. The company manages proven reserves of 260 billion barrels of oil and manages the fourth-largest gas reserves in the world, 253.8 trillion cubic feet. In addition to its headquarters in Dhahran, Saudi Arabia, Saudi Aramco has affiliates, joint ventures and subsidiary offices in China, Japan, the Netherlands, the Republic of Korea, Singapore, Malaysia, the United Arab Emirates, the United Kingdom and the United States.
